All About Hannah Watts Park, Melton
Hannah Watts Park, also known as Melton Rec Res, is a popular recreational space located at 183-225 High St, Melton VIC 3337. The park offers a wide range of amenities, including a playground, picnic area, sports fields, and walking paths, making it the perfect destination for families and sports enthusiasts alike. Its picturesque surroundings and well-maintained facilities make it an ideal spot for outdoor activities and gatherings. The Best Transport for Hannah Watts Park, Melton:
- If you are coming from Melbourne CBD, the best public transport option is to take the V-Line train to Melton Station. From there, you can catch a local bus or a taxi to Hannah Watts Park.
- If you prefer driving, there is ample parking available at the park. It's a straightforward 40-minute drive from Melbourne CBD via the M8 and Western Freeway.
- Cycling is another great option, with dedicated bike paths leading to the park from surrounding areas. Just make sure to use Google Maps or another cycling app to plan your route.
